Communication Devices and Acquired Brain Injuries

Communication Devices and Acquired Brain Injuries:

Exploring communication devices, different access methods and what to look for when trialing high tech communication devices after an acquired brain injury.

About Kirstin White, B.S., SLPA:

Kirstin White, B.S., SLPA has been working in the speech and AAC world for over ten years. She has worked with Tobii Dynavox as the Austin Texas consultant for the last four, supporting those with complex communication needs. Starting as a teenager she worked with children with communication devices, which she turned into a career as a SLPA at a pediatric clinic and now combines that experience to provide support in a variety of settings for individuals across the lifespan. Bringing people a voice is something she’s truly passionate about.

About Kristy Gibson, M.A., CCC-SLP:

Kristy Gibson, M.A., CCC-SLP has supported individuals with a variety of complex/communication needs for over 20 years, enjoying the last 3 years with Tobii Dynavox. Her combined experience as an educator, assistive technology provider and speech-language pathologist across the lifespan for individuals with complex communication needs has allowed Kristy experiences in a variety of practice settings & state/national conference presentations.
